From a rainfall point of view Zalensky Pond is a reasonably common location; the month with most of the rain is June while February is the month with the least amount of precipitation. For the duration of the days of summer here at Zalensky Pond, high temperatures regularly get
| | | |
| | into the 80's. All through the dark hours of summer temperatures fall down into the 50's. High temperatures during the winter are normally in the 10's with temperatures at Zalensky Pond dipping down into the-10's during winter nights. This lake is so wonderful.
